MMM5471330 Astrolabe, detail of a plate with a projection of Rojas, 1702 (object) by Bion, Nicolas (1652-1733); National Maritime Museum, London, UK; (add.info.: Astrolabe, detail of a plaque with a projection of Rojas, a rare copy of an astrolabe printed on paper, cut out and mounted on cardboard. This instrument is said to be complete because it includes different types of astrolabes, describing the history and development of these tools, and the fact that it is brightly colored, seems to indicate that this object is a teaching tool. Object made in 1702, by Nicolas Bion (1652-1733).); © National Maritime Museum, Greenwich, London

This stunning print captures the intricate details of an Astrolabe, specifically a plate with a projection of Rojas from 1702. Created by Nicolas Bion, this rare copy of an astrolabe is printed on paper, cut out, and mounted on cardboard. The object is said to be complete as it includes different types of astrolabes that describe the history and development of these tools. The brightly colored design suggests that this particular astrolabe was used as a teaching tool in the early 18th century.
